Transaction df20686cc41c120505fede908ed7fc84440eb2e1a3abb4ef1e5b9b2d628ae6bb
1 Input
1 Outputs
- df20686cc41c120505fede908ed7fc84440eb2e1a3abb4ef1e5b9b2d628ae6bb:0
value 30091499
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u